View From The Top (2003)
Ending / spoiler
Directed by: Bruno Barreto
Starring: Gwyneth Paltrow, Mark Ruffalo, Rob Lowe, Christina Applegate, Mike Myers, Candice Bergen
Donna gets stuck on Express flights, but gets Sally Weston to review her test and discovers the truth-Christine stole her test. Donna gets to fly "Paris, first class, international" but finds it doesn't make her truly happy. She reunites with Ted, and the film ends with her being a pilot.

Trivia: Just something to look for: in the scene when Gwenyth Paltrow goes to see Mike Myers about how she thinks her test scores were messed up, she asks him if she can retest and he says, "That's not procedure." The shot then goes back to her and you can see a plaque on the wall that says "That's Procedure."
